LOG: Revert r374202"[ObjC generics] Fix not inheriting type bounds in categories/extensions."

This introduced new errors, see below. Reverting until that can be investigated
properly.

  #import <AVFoundation/AVFoundation.h>

  void f(int width, int height) {
    FourCharCode best_fourcc = kCMPixelFormat_422YpCbCr8_yuvs;
    NSDictionary* videoSettingsDictionary = @{
      (id)kCVPixelBufferPixelFormatTypeKey : @(best_fourcc),
    };
  }

  $ clang++ -c /tmp/a.mm

  /tmp/a.mm:6:5: error: cannot initialize a parameter of type
  'KeyType<NSCopying>  _Nonnull const' (aka 'const id') with an rvalue
  of type 'id'
      (id)kCVPixelBufferPixelFormatTypeKey : @(best_fourcc),
      ^~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
  1 error generated.

> When a category/extension doesn't repeat a type bound, corresponding
> type parameter is substituted with `id` when used as a type argument. As
> a result, in the added test case it was causing errors like
>
> > type argument 'T' (aka 'id') does not satisfy the bound ('id<NSCopying>') of type parameter 'T'
>
> We are already checking that type parameters should be consistent
> everywhere (see `checkTypeParamListConsistency`) and update
> `ObjCTypeParamDecl` to have correct underlying type. And when we use the
> type parameter as a method return type or a method parameter type, it is
> substituted to the bounded type. But when we use the type parameter as a
> type argument, we check `ObjCTypeParamType` that ignores the updated
> underlying type and remains `id`.
>
> Fix by desugaring `ObjCTypeParamType` to the underlying type, the same
> way we are doing with `TypedefType`.
